Output d629027167ebc11b757a549d710536e9d9e2d42a7fa5b1b48b5320886968b666:3

value
19840266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 375578b1327ad5fd07a92837451c32fda327d982 OP_EQUALVERIFY OP_CHECKSIG
address
163aZDG8s2vUy96E3RduUhh5ycrjmqHBHL
transaction
d629027167ebc11b757a549d710536e9d9e2d42a7fa5b1b48b5320886968b666
spent
true